C13H16N4O2 — CID 66016746
N-benzyl-3-ethyl-1-methyl-4-nitropyrazol-5-amine (PubChem CID 66016746) has the molecular formula C13H16N4O2 and a molecular weight of 260.30 g/mol. Its IUPAC name is N-benzyl-3-ethyl-1-methyl-4-nitropyrazol-5-amine.
